Abstract
aparelho, conjunto de circuitos integrados ou chips, dispositivo de posicionamento, método, programa de computador, e, sinal. aparelho compreende: um primeiro dispositivo de correlação configurado para correlacionar um primeiro componente de sinal com um primeiro código para fornecer uma primeira saída, o mencionado primeiro componente de sinal tendo uma frequência de portadora e dados; um segundo dispositivo de correlação configurado para correlacionar um segundo componente de sinal com um segundo código para fornecer uma segunda saída, o mencionado segundo componente de sinal tendo a mesma frequência de portadora que o primeiro componente de sinal e os mesmos dados que o primeiro componente de sinal, os mencionados dados no segundo componente de sinal sendo retardado com relação aos dados no primeiro componente de sinal; e um processador configurada para processar a primeira e segunda saídas, os mencionados dados na mencionada primeira saída estando alinhados com a segunda saída para fornecer informação de frequência sobre a mencionada portadora.
